Default Electrical Issue

Have a 1961 that was working fine the last few weeks, then the other day, didn't want to start anymore.

It won't turn over at all.

Replaced the battery, same thing.

Occasionally, it will click a few times when I try to start it, then nothing.

The dome light goes out too, kind of like when the car doesn't start, the whole thing loses power completely.

I'm not familiar with the wiring for this car yet, but I'm wondering what might cause the whole thing to lose power like that when it fails... Yesterday, power would eventually come back. However, in the last 24 hours, it hasn't returned at all since the last failure...

Any ideas where to begin?

Additional troubleshooting has me thinking that the problem is between the battery and it's first point of contact with the car on the positive terminal.

If I work and manipulate that wire, power comes back to the car. But, as soon as I try to turn it over, I get the same power loss.

I can't tell how or what that wire is connected to on the other end.

Anyone familiar with what is at the other end of that wire?
